Question 2: What is the pay on a four-number wager?
- 7 to 1
- 9 to 1
- 8 to 1 (Correct answer)
- You cannot bet on 4 numbers with a single bet.
Correct answer: 8 to 1
A four-number wager, often called a 'corner bet' or 'square bet,' covers four numbers that meet at a single corner on the betting layout. The standard payout for this type of bet in roulette is 8 to 1. This means that if your chosen four numbers include the winning number, you receive eight times your original bet in winnings, plus your initial stake back.
Question 3: What is the payout on a straight up wager (one that only covers one number)?
- 36 to 1
- 35 to 1 (Correct answer)
- 1 to 1
- 2 to 1
Correct answer: 35 to 1
A straight-up wager in roulette involves placing a bet on a single number. This type of bet offers the highest payout due to its low probability of winning. The standard payout for a straight-up wager is 35 to 1, meaning you win 35 times your original bet if your chosen number hits, in addition to getting your initial stake back.
Question 4: True or false: The wheel and ball always spin in the same direction.
- False (Correct answer)
- True
Correct answer: False
It is false that the wheel and ball always spin in the same direction. In fact, a fundamental aspect of roulette play is that the dealer spins the roulette wheel in one direction and then launches the ball in the opposite direction. This counter-rotation is designed to ensure maximum randomness and unpredictability in where the ball will land.

Question 6: True or False: You can place bets until the ball lands on a specific number.
- False (Correct answer)
- True
Correct answer: False
Players are not permitted to place bets until the ball lands on a specific number. The dealer will announce 'No more bets' (or 'Rien ne va plus' in French) while the ball is still spinning, indicating that all wagers must be placed before this point. This rule ensures fairness and prevents players from betting after the outcome becomes too predictable.
Question 7: Do you understand why roulette is occasionally referred to as "The Devil's Game"?
- The numbers on the wheel add up to 666. (Correct answer)
- Gambling is considered evil, and roulette is the first casino game invented.
- The man who invented it was possessed by a demon
- Red and black are considered evil colors
Correct answer: The numbers on the wheel add up to 666.
Roulette is often referred to as 'The Devil's Game' because the sum of all the numbers on a traditional roulette wheel, from 1 to 36, adds up to 666. This intriguing numerical coincidence has contributed to the game's mystique and its ominous nickname throughout history, linking it to a symbol of evil.
